Definition of Glory / Honor

Al-Majd refers to glory and honor.

The Almighty says: 'The Glorious' (Al-Buruj 15), attribute of Allah.

Al-Majīd is one of Allah's Names.

Majjada means to glorify.

At-tamjīd is glorification.

Surah Hud : 73 Meccan
﴿قَالُوٓا۟ أَتَعْجَبِينَ مِنْ أَمْرِ ٱللَّهِ رَحْمَتُ ٱللَّهِ وَبَرَكَٰتُهُۥ عَلَيْكُمْ أَهْلَ ٱلْبَيْتِ إِنَّهُۥ حَمِيدٌ مَّجِيدٌ
They said, "Are you amazed at the decree of Allah? May the mercy of Allah and His blessings be upon you, people of the house. Indeed, He is Praiseworthy and Honorable."
Surah Qaf : 1 Meccan
﴿قٓ وَٱلْقُرْءَانِ ٱلْمَجِيدِ
Qaf. By the honored Qur'an...
Surah Al-Buruj : 15 Meccan
﴿ذُو ٱلْعَرْشِ ٱلْمَجِيدُ
Honorable Owner of the Throne,
Surah Al-Buruj : 21 Meccan
﴿بَلْ هُوَ قُرْءَانٌ مَّجِيدٌ
But this is an honored Qur'an
